The present work deals with the structure study of. Eu0.65Sr0.35Mn1- xFexO3 (x= 0.1, 0.5, and 0.7) by X-ray diffraction. These compounds were prepared from pure 99.9% oxides using standard solid state reaction. The final sintering temperature was 1350°C for 72 h. The X-ray analysis showed that all samples have a single perovskite structure phase, which crystallizes in orthorhombic system with space group Pbnm. An increase in the lattice volume was found upon increasing the iron concentration. The mean bond length (Mn/Fe – O) increases linearly with increasing the iron content. Less distortion in MO6 octahedron is obtained for low iron content (x=0.1).
